While most cannabis enthusiasts are familiar with things like THC and CBD, few know about terpenes. In short, cannabis derived terpenes are responsible for the smell a cannabis plant has.
They are also responsible for the flavor that comes with a cannabis plant. Terpenes also provide a myriad of therapeutic and medicinal benefits. These benefits can help people suffering from depression and insomnia.

2. Terpenes Are Found Throughout Nature
Some people think that terpenes are only contained in the cannabis plant. This could not be farther from the truth. Many fruits and plants contain terpenes that affect how they smell and taste. For instance, when you smell a flow, you are really experiencing a potent collection of terpenes.
Terpenes are also found in things like pine trees and honey. If a particular fruit or plant has a definable and potent smell, chances are it contains lots of terpenes.
